Southern Style Buttermilk Pie (makes 2 Pies) Ingredients

-- MIX --3 1/2 cups White Sugar Blend
7 lrg Eggs 3/4 cup Flour Blend
1 teaspoon Salt 1 cup Buttermilk Blend
1 1/2 teaspoons Pure Vanilla Extract 2/3 cup Melted Margarine Not to hot/Blend
-- ADD --2 deep Dish Pie Shells

Instructions for Southern Style Buttermilk Pie (makes 2 Pies)

Mix all ingredients well and pour into 2 (two) unbaked pie shells.Bake for 45 minutes to 1 hour at 325? degree oven. If a puddle of butter forms in the middle of the pie, pour off and return to the oven. Test with tooth pick to make sure pie is done. (tooth pick will come out clean when pie is done.

Serve warm or cold,garnish with whipped cream and or a lemon wedge
